Curriculum
The Royal Ballet School of Antwerp offers a full-time Arts Secondary Education (September-June), consisting of a dance and a scholastic programme. This programme trains dancers with a strong classical foundation, who can also cope with the modern dance repertoire. The curriculum is designed for students between 12 and 18 years of age who are pursuing a career in dance, and who want to combine a degree in classical ballet with a secondary education diploma in order to optimise their chances for employment opportunities and successful higher education. The Royal Ballet School of Antwerp welcomes both national and international students.
